Mercedes duo chasing balance to match Red Bull

Lewis Hamilton Lewis Hamilton and Valtteri Bottas were left chasing set-up improvements following the opening day of track action at the Formula 1 Mexico City Grand Prix. The Mercedes drivers were second and third fastest in Free Practice 2, the pair visibly struggling for balance in comparison to title leader Max Verstappen. Hamilton’s best of 1:17.810s came midway through the 60-minute session as teams focused on qualifying simulations. While that effort was more than half a second off the pace of Verstappen, a second effort from Mercedes team-mate Bottas offered a glimmer of hope.
